2025 Annual Minnesota Keystone Celebration
This annual Minnesota Keystone Luncheon event celebrates Minnesota's tradition of corporate social responsibility, philanthropic giving and the strong tradition of corporate giving. The program also recognizes three Minnesota Keystone companies in the small-, mid-, and large-sized categories for their innovations in giving. Members of the program give at least two percent of their pre-tax earnings to charitable organizations and are acknowledged for their outstanding giving programs at this event.
